深入解析“tpflow爬虫”:原理、应用与未来趋势
一、tpflow爬虫的基本原理
“tpflow爬虫”是一种基于特定规则自动抓取互联网数据的程序。它通过模拟人类在网络上的浏览行为,按照一定的算法和规则,自动地访问并收集各个网站上的信息。这些被收集的信息可以是文本、图片、链接等多种形式,经过处理和分析后,能够为用户提供有价值的数据支持。
tpflow爬虫的核心原理主要包括以下几个步骤:首先,确定抓取目标,即要明确需要从哪些网站或页面上抓取数据。其次,设计合适的爬虫策略,这包括选择适当的爬虫算法、设置合理的访问频率以及应对可能的反爬虫机制等。接下来,爬虫开始自动地遍历目标网站,抓取并下载所需数据。最后,对这些数据进行清洗、整合和存储,以便于后续的分析和利用。
二、tpflow爬虫的应用场景
随着大数据技术的不断发展,tpflow爬虫在多个领域都展现出了广泛的应用前景。以下是一些典型的应用场景:
1. 市场行情分析:在金融领域,通过tpflow爬虫可以实时抓取各大金融网站的市场行情数据,如股票价格、汇率变动等。这些数据对于投资者来说具有重要的参考价值,能够帮助他们做出更为明智的投资决策。
2. 竞品分析:在商业竞争中,了解竞品的动态和市场策略至关重要。tpflow爬虫可以协助企业收集竞品的相关信息,如产品价格、促销活动、客户评价等,从而为企业制定有效的市场竞争策略提供数据支持。
3. 新闻舆情监控:在公共关系和危机管理领域,tpflow爬虫能够实时监控各大新闻网站和社交媒体上的舆情动态。这对于政府部门和企业来说,是及时发现并应对舆论危机的重要手段。
4. 学术研究:在科研领域,tpflow爬虫也被广泛用于收集各种学术资源和研究数据。它能够帮助研究人员从海量的网络信息中筛选出有价值的研究素材,提高研究效率。
三、tpflow爬虫的挑战与应对策略
虽然tpflow爬虫在数据获取方面展现出了强大的能力,但在实际应用过程中也面临着不少挑战。其中,最主要的挑战来自于网站的反爬虫机制。为了保护自身数据不被恶意抓取,许多网站都设置了各种复杂的反爬虫手段,如验证码验证、IP封锁等。这些措施在很大程度上限制了tpflow爬虫的抓取效率。
为了应对这些挑战,研究者和技术人员需要不断探索新的方法和技术。例如,可以通过优化爬虫算法、利用代理IP池、模拟人类行为等方式来提高爬虫的隐蔽性和抗反爬虫能力。同时,也要注重合法合规的使用爬虫技术,避免侵犯他人的合法权益。
四、tpflow爬虫的未来发展趋势
随着技术的不断进步和互联网环境的日益复杂,tpflow爬虫也在不断发展演变。未来,我们可以预见到以下几个发展趋势:
1. 智能化与自学习能力的增强:随着人工智能技术的深入应用,未来的tpflow爬虫将具备更强的智能化和自学习能力。它们能够自动识别和适应不同网站的结构变化,提高抓取的准确性和效率。
2. 分布式与云计算技术的结合:随着大数据时代的到来,分布式爬虫和云计算技术将进一步融合。这将使得tpflow爬虫在处理海量数据时更加高效稳定,同时降低运营成本。
3. 隐私保护与数据安全性的提升:在数据抓取过程中,如何保护用户隐私和数据安全将成为一个越来越重要的问题。未来的tpflow爬虫将更加注重隐私保护措施的实施,确保在合法合规的前提下进行数据抓取和分析。
综上所述,“tpflow爬虫”作为一种强大的数据抓取工具,在信息时代扮演着举足轻重的角色。通过深入了解其原理、应用以及面临的挑战和发展趋势,我们能够更好地把握这一技术的精髓和价值所在,为未来的数据分析和应用奠定坚实的基础。